Transaction 21e75f5984a34ed2ae25d3464444a5060d122a937c213271dcf3a4217ed510f6

3 Input
2 Outputs
  • 21e75f5984a34ed2ae25d3464444a5060d122a937c213271dcf3a4217ed510f6:0
  • value  2630600
    address  157S5awFgTYP2YioHBnMbbB2qnZqYG3hQL
  • 21e75f5984a34ed2ae25d3464444a5060d122a937c213271dcf3a4217ed510f6:1
  • value  2841
    address  bc1qym8qyled2age0667dhnr80alcrsmya3635fxly